    What Are the Techniques Used in AI Question Generation?

    Various techniques are employed in AI question generation, including rule-based systems, machine learning models, and deep learning approaches, each contributing uniquely to the effectiveness of generating high-quality questions.

    Rule-based systems rely on predefined templates and patterns, making them straightforward and easy to implement. However, their rigidity can limit creative question variation.

    In contrast, machine learning models utilize historical data to learn and adapt, offering greater flexibility, though they often require substantial training data to achieve optimal performance.

    Deep learning approaches, such as neural networks, can analyze vast amounts of text data to generate more nuanced and contextually relevant questions, enhancing the quality and variety of assessments. While deep learning models are capable of producing highly sophisticated questions, they can demand significant computational resources and may occasionally generate errors or incoherent outputs.

    What Are the Challenges of AI Question Generation?

    Despite advancements in AI question generation, several challenges persist that can affect the quality and applicability of the generated content. Key challenges include ensuring contextual relevance, avoiding bias in question formulation, and addressing the limitations of current AI algorithms in understanding nuanced concepts and human emotions.

    Content analysis may lead to inaccuracies if the source material is ambiguous or poorly structured, presenting further hurdles for educators who rely on AI-generated assessments. These issues can result in questions that are either overly simplistic or fail to accurately reflect the learning objectives set by educators.

    For example, a scenario in which students are tested on complex ethical dilemmas might yield generic questions that lack depth and critical thinking components. Additionally, biases may inadvertently emerge if AI systems are trained on unbalanced datasets, potentially affecting the fairness of assessments.

    To address these challenges, developers are exploring advanced techniques such as incorporating human-in-the-loop systems, which ensure that trained educators review and refine AI-generated questions, resulting in content that better aligns with curricular goals and promotes a fairer assessment environment.

    Can AI-Generated Questions Replace Human-Created Questions?

    The ongoing debate regarding whether AI-generated questions can fully replace those created by humans presents various arguments on both sides. While AI can efficiently produce a large volume of questions quickly, it often falls short in terms of depth, creativity, and contextual understanding that human educators contribute to the assessment process.

    Human-created questions can be tailored to address the specific needs of students, incorporating real-world scenarios and innovative approaches that current AI algorithms may overlook. Conversely, AI-generated questions excel in providing standardized assessments and ensuring consistency in evaluation across large groups.

    Their ability to analyze vast amounts of data enables the generation of questions based on prevalent knowledge gaps and trends, allowing educators to focus their instruction where it is most needed. However, reliance on algorithmic approaches raises concerns about potential biases and a lack of nuanced understanding of student emotions and learning styles.

    Therefore, in high-stakes environments where personalized feedback and ethical considerations are paramount, the importance of integrating human judgment with AI capabilities cannot be overstated.
